Crystal Structure of Purine Nucleoside Phosphorylase Isoform 2 from Schistosoma mansoni in complex with 4-methylpyridin-2-olCrystal Structure of Purine Nucleoside Phosphorylase Isoform 2 from Schistosoma mansoni in complex with 4-methylpyridin-2-ol
Structural highlights
Function[A0A0U3AGT1_SCHMA] The purine nucleoside phosphorylases catalyze the phosphorolytic breakdown of the N-glycosidic bond in the beta-(deoxy)ribonucleoside molecules, with the formation of the corresponding free purine bases and pentose-1-phosphate.[PIRNR:PIRNR000477] |
